Station Accessibility
Step-free access
Step-free access to all platforms - may include long or steep ramps. Access between platforms may be via the street.
This is a Category B1 station: Step Free access to all platforms.
Access to all platforms via long (approx. 60 metres) steep (approx. 1:10 gradient) ramps from main entrance/concourse at all times.
Lift access is available to all platforms via the Lansdowne Road/Dingwall Road entrance 0600-0000.
The Assistance Meeting Point is the by Information Point on station concourse.

Helpline
- Helpline,Monday to Sunday: Available
The assisted helpline is not available on Christmas Day.
Staff are available at this station from the first to last trains of the day, for providing assistance getting on and off the train and assisting around the station and platforms. Assistance can be provided unbooked (turn up and go) or pre booked up to two hours before departure by contacting Assisted Travel.
Whether you pre book assistance or travel unbooked, please contact a member of staff on arrival. We recommend arriving 20 minutes prior to your train departing. This is to allow us to make sure arrangements are in place at your destination, or interchange, station such as the availability of staff and lifts. If there is insufficient time to check these arrangements, we may assist you onto the next available train.
